- Instance method (also known as members of the method used to describe the intrinsic behavior of the object): The current default instance of an object is passed as the first argument
- Method class (class method defining, in the above method must be added @classmethod ): the current default class as the first parameter passed
- Static methods (static methods when defining the method must be added on top @staticmethod ): The first argument is no default
